paddleocr使用识别文字
时间: 2023-10-10 07:12:49 浏览: 152
paddleocr是一种基于PaddlePaddle深度学习框架的开源OCR(Optical Character Recognition,光学字符识别)工具。它可以用于离线识别印刷体文字,并具有较强的识别能力。相比于其他OCR工具如easyocr,paddleocr的效果和功能各有长短。
您可以通过使用paddleocr库来识别文字。根据引用内容,paddleocr不需要联网,可以在离线环境下进行文字识别。在PC端,您可以通过访问超轻量级中文OCR在线体验地址(https://www.paddlepaddle.org.***一篇文字的识别可能需要5-10秒的时间,这取决于使用的设备和硬件资源。此外,根据引用,在使用paddleocr时,可能会遇到一些错误和不支持较新版本的问题。
相关问题
PaddleOCR文字识别命令
PaddleOCR是一个基于深度学习的开源OCR(Optical Character Recognition,光学字符识别)库,它由百度飞桨开发。使用PaddleOCR进行文字识别通常涉及以下几个步骤的命令行操作:
1. 安装PaddleOCR:首先需要安装PaddleOCR及其依赖,可以使用pip进行安装:
```
pip install paddlepaddle-cpu paddleocr
```
2. 准备数据集:你需要准备一些带有标注的文字图像数据,PaddleOCR支持多种格式的数据输入。
3. 运行识别:对于单张图片识别,你可以使用`paddleocr`命令行工具,例如:
```
python tools/infer/predict_system.py -i <image_path> --use_angle_cls True
```
其中,`<image_path>`是你要识别的图片路径,`--use_angle_cls True`表示启用角度校正。
4. 配置模型:PaddleOCR提供了多种预训练模型,如CCNet、CRNN等,通过修改配置文件(如config.yml)可以选择合适的模型。
5. 测试效果:识别完成后,会输出识别的结果,你可以查看识别出的文字内容。
注意:每个版本的PaddleOCR可能会有细微的变化,所以在使用前建议查阅最新的官方文档或教程。
yolo加paddleocr文字识别
YOLO (You Only Look Once) 和 PaddleOCR 是两个独立的开源项目,分别在目标检测和文本识别领域有着广泛应用。
YOLO 是一种快速实时的目标检测算法,它的主要特点是速度非常快,适合于实时场景如视频监控。YOLO将图像划分成网格,每个网格预测多个边界框和它们对应的目标类别概率,一次前向传播就能完成目标检测。
PaddleOCR 则是由 paddlepaddle(一个基于 Python 的深度学习框架)开发的文本识别工具,它支持多种识别任务,包括行文字、表格文字等,使用深度学习模型如 CRNN (Convolutional Recurrent Neural Networks) 进行文字识别。PaddleOCR提供了丰富的预训练模型和易用的接口,使得非专业人士也能方便地进行文本识别应用。
如果你想将 YOLO 与 PaddleOCR 结合,一个常见的应用场景可能是先用 YOLO 定位图像中的文本区域,然后对这些区域进行裁剪并输入到 PaddleOCR 中进行精准的文字识别。这种结合可以帮助提高整体系统的定位和识别精度,尤其是在复杂背景或者密集文本的情况下。
阅读全文